An onboard-vehicle system (figure 1, 1) for guiding a driver of a vehicle to follow an intended path 4. The system comprises: means 12 for memorising and/or transmitting to the system in real time and/or computing at the system the intended path 4, means 15 for measuring the actual position of the vehicle, a visual display unit (VDU) 11, arrangeable in use within at least the peripheral vision of the driver of the vehicle, means for displaying in real time on the VDU 11 the intended path 4 to be driven and means for displaying to the driver: at least lateral actual position of the vehicle’s with respect to the intended path 4 and a return path 21 to the intended path. The system also comprises means to communicate whether the vehicle should speed up, maintain speed or slow down for synchronisation with the intended path. The current path being taken and the return path may be displayed via arrows 22, 23, wherein the relationship between the current path and the return path is shown by the relationship of their arrows, in terms of their angles and magnitudes. The return path may be indicated in a manner that it forms an invert Y with the intended path.
